Is there some kind person who will check the details of the household for this person in 1911, please.
HOLLING FLORENCE EMILY F 1885 26 Chepstow Monmouthshire. It actually should be Hollins.

HOLLING, John Head Married M 48 1863 Coal Merchant Haulage Contractor Chepstow HOLLING, Matilda Wife Married 30 years F 53 1858 Grocer And Baker Chepstow HOLLING, Florence Emily Daughter Single F 26 1885 Book Keeping Coal Business Chepstow HOLLING, Percy Son Single M 24 1887 Baker Chepstow HOLLING, Ronald Son Single M 21 1890 Baker Chepstow HOLLING, Cyril Son Single M 19 1892 Assisting Coal Business Chepstow HOLLING, John Son Single M 17 1894 Assisting Coal Business Chepstow HOLLING, Audrey Daughter Single F 11 1900 School Chepstow JONES, Rachel Servant Single F 21 1890 Domestic Chepstow
RG number: RG14 Piece: 31697 Reference: RG14PN31697 RG78PN1822 RD582 SD1 ED19 SN279 Registration District: Chepstow Sub District: Chepstow Enumeration District: 19 Parish: Chepstow Address: 10 Church ST County: Monmouthshire
** it is a very scrawly "s" on the end of the name!
